Living in a big city with a high workload, lifestyle and diet is also unhealthy cause people susceptible to disease. To boost immunity, the consumption of probiotics is very necessary.
Sources of probiotics include yogurt is already known. Although made from milk, but yogurt is safe for those who are allergic to milk. This is because the levels of lactose in the milk is reduced as a result of the fermentation process.
Yogurt comes from the Turkish language, which means sour milk. So called because the basic ingredients of yogurt is milk fermented with one or more of good bacteria known as probiotics.
The good bacteria such as Lactobacillus bulgaricus and Streptococcus thermophilus. These bacteria outlines the milk sugar (lactose) into lactic acid. Lactic acid is what makes the milk becomes stale and sour.
Dr.Marya Haryono, MGizi, SpGK, from the Faculty of Medicine, University of Indonesia explained, although it tasted sour, but yogurt is safe for those who suffer from heartburn.
"Precisely yogurt can reduce the bacteria that cause gastritis or ulcer helicobacter phylori. These bacteria cause injury to the stomach, nah yogurt also can treat the wounds," he said in a show titled "Getting Healthy with Yogurt while Fasting" Heavenly Blush held in Jakarta (7 / 7/15).
